The sea is a mirror of the sky. The land is a mirror of the light.

So much of what we see are reflections of something else, even of our personality. I am fascinated by this duality both of perception and action.

We are always observing horizons, that vanishing point where land meets eternity and my abstracts are often about this meeting point.

In my paintings everything is connected visually or “as above, so below” as the ancient mystics explained it.
